The initial and first hand mission of the United States Secret Service formed on 14th April 1865 was to investigate about the money counterfeiting.

Answer: Option 1

<u>Explanation: </u>

The vision with which United States Secret Service was formed, was the motive for investigation of the instances where possibly counterfeit of United States currency have been sought.

Later to which it was broadened into investigation of perpetual fraud against the government. After the William McKinley was assassinated, their mission was also prolonged to protect the President as well as the President elect.

Post-traumatic stress disorder is unique among psychological disorders because:
goblinko [34]

The answer is A. The cause of the disorder may be specified with certainty.

Post-traumatic stress disorder is a mental health condition that is triggered by a terrifying event which can arise from either experiencing or witnessing the event. Symptoms of this disorder may include flashbacks, nightmares and severe anxiety, as well as uncontrollable thoughts about the event.
